Stars shooting

Meteor showers, or ‘shooting stars’, are another stunning natural phenomena. This cosmic occurrence occurs when Earth travels through a comet or asteroid’s debris. As many as 162,000 people seek for meteor showers each month. Volcanic activity

Volcanism is a powerful natural phenomenon. Volcanoes release hot lava, volcanic ash, and gases. Volcano tourism has grown in the recent decade. The day after Mount Kilauea erupted in December 2020, Hawaii Volcanoes National Park noticed a surge in tourists. Travelers visit prominent volcanoes like Mount Vesuvius and Hawaii to observe lava flow. Since 2004, global searches for ‘volcano tour’ have surged 5000%. Hot-springs

Travelers typically include hot springs on their bucket lists. Hot water rises from deep in the Earth to generate warm pools in hot springs. Relaxing in them has long been a favorite hobby because to its stress relieving and skin detoxifying benefits.
